A Hong Kong man was arrested after trying to smuggle 330 grams of the party drug Ice, or crystal meth, from the mainland, police said on Thursday.
The man, 49, was stopped by police and customs officers at the immigration hall at the Lo Wu border control point, while returning from Shenzhen on Wednesday afternoon.
A search of his bag revealed the 330 grams of the drug concealed in seven packets, and he was later placed under arrest. The haul had an estimated street value of HK$254,000.
Shenzhen is one of the mainland’s biggest gateways for the import and export of illicit drugs. It has become a popular destination for Hong Kong drug users and smugglers in recent years.
